Extraction protocol |
The PrEGM- and WIT-expanded cells from either bulk or FACS-purified human benign prostatic basal and luminal cells are subject to total RNA extraction by RNeasy mini kit (Qiagen, Valencia, CA). Illumina TruSeq Stranded Total RNA Preparation Kit (Illumina, cat#: RS-122-2301) was used with 1 ug of total RNA for the construction of sequencing libraries. RNA libraries were prepared for sequencing using standard Illumina protocols

Data processing |
Basecalling was done by Illumina analysis pipeline CASAVA (version 1.8.2). The reads were mapped to human genome (hg38) by TopHat (version 2.0.10) and Bowtie2 (version 2.1.0). The number of fragments in each known gene from GENCODE Release 21 was enumerated using htseq-count from HTSeq package (version 0.6.0). Genes with less than 10 fragments in all the samples were removed, and then the normalized fragment count for each gene was calculated by R/Bioconductor package DESeq (version 1.16.0). Genome_build: hg38 Supplementary_files_format_and_content: The first column is Ensembl gene id. The other columns are normalized expression values (estimated by DESeq) for all the samples.
